Open gedit from the applications menu.

Press the Open icon and open a text file. Gedit will then close.

Go to the file menu and open a file using Open. Gedit will then close.

Go to the file menu and open a file from the list of recent opened
files at the bottom. Gedit will *not* close.

Open it from the command line using gedit and then open a file using
the open icon. gedit will *not* close.

Open it from the command line using gedit and then open a file using
the file menu and open. gedit will *not* close.
